How Does Face Swap Affect Your Privacy?

In an era where digital content creation is at an all-time high, face swap technology has surged in popularity. This innovative tool allows users to swap faces in images or videos with just a few clicks. While it’s a source of amusement and creative expression, the implications for user privacy are significant and merit careful consideration.

Immediate Access to Personal Data

Intrusive Data Collection

When you use a face swap application, the software requires access to your device’s camera and photo library. This seemingly harmless permission can lead to extensive data harvesting. For instance, some apps not only access the photos you select for face swapping but also scan your entire photo album, collecting data on the people you frequently photograph, the locations tagged in your photos, and even the time stamps of when these photos were taken.

Storage and Usage of Facial Data

Once your images are uploaded to a face swap server, they are often stored for periods longer than necessary. A study from the University of California revealed that over 60% of face swap apps retain user images for more than one month, with some keeping the data indefinitely unless a user specifically requests deletion. This prolonged data retention poses a risk, as servers holding vast amounts of personal information become prime targets for cyberattacks.

Potential for Misuse

Identity Theft

The most alarming risk associated with face swap technology is its potential to facilitate identity theft. Cybercriminals can use swapped images to create fake online profiles or fraudulent documents. Since face swap technology is designed to produce very realistic results, these counterfeit images can be convincing enough to pass for genuine, leading to possible financial and personal repercussions for the unsuspecting victims.

Unauthorized Use in Advertising

There’s also the risk of your face swapped images being used without your consent in digital advertising. With just a few alterations, images generated from face swap apps can be repurposed in marketing campaigns, often without the original user’s knowledge or approval. This practice not only infringes on personal rights but also raises questions about the ethical use of one’s likeness in public domains.

Safeguarding Your Privacy

Critical App Choices

To protect yourself, it’s vital to choose face swap applications that transparently explain their data use policies. Opt for apps that offer robust privacy settings and explicitly state that they do not store your images for longer than necessary. Checking app reviews and updates regularly can provide insights into how the app handles privacy concerns over time.

Limiting App Permissions

Be cautious about the permissions you grant to any application. If a face swap app requests access to information that isn’t necessary for its functionality, consider this a red flag. Limiting permissions can significantly reduce the risk of unauthorized data access.

User Education and Awareness

Educating yourself about the risks and settings associated with face swap technology is crucial. Awareness campaigns and educational resources can help users understand and navigate the privacy implications more effectively.
